My $0.02 is that it's fine, but I think anybody who tints their brake lights is a fool. If you really wanna do something to your tails, that seems a good option because at least it doesn't touch the brake lights.

I've said it before but I'll say it again: It's not like Mercedes just threw any old bulb into those brake lights. They're made as bright as they are for a reason. Dimming them is begging to be rear-ended and is really doing a disservice to the people that will be behind you. All in the name of cosmetics.
